The document discusses heap data structures and their use in priority queues and heapsort. It defines a heap as a complete binary tree stored in an array. Each node stores a value, with the heap property being that a node's value is greater than or equal to its children's values (for a max heap). Algorithms like Max-Heapify, Build-Max-Heap, Heap-Extract-Max, and Heap-Increase-Key are presented to maintain the heap property during operations. Priority queues use heaps to efficiently retrieve the maximum element, while heapsort sorts an array by building a max heap and repeatedly extracting elements.
